After reading through forums, looking at belt nos fitted and talking to many members i was a little confused. The posts and forums recommend a gates T 987 timming belt however both engines we have had the MD179620 mitsubishi belt which converts to a T 954.
A little more reserch proved the T 954 is the correct one for our belt.
The reasoning for this is the T 987 has 232 teeth and the T 954 has 226.
The incorrect length belt allows the tensioner to be at its maximun before the belt even stretches or has any wear, or at its minimum making it to tight.
So a note to all when you change your timming belt ensure you get the correct ammount of teeth your car has had originaly fitted or premature replacement may be on the cards.

    Good info thou! No ones been able to tell me the Non Mivec Gates number (or the teeth differeences.) I'll just redisplay it here with all associated buzz words so it can be easly found when seached for :)

    Gates Mivec timing belt (GPX) - T987 (232 teeth)
    Gates Non-Mivec timing belt (GR) - T954 (226 teeth)
